    AK-47s which generally are actually AKMs are well known for their high reliability even when poorly maintained and tortured. But your point about how war video games leave out undesirable realistic factors, ofcourse they leave out things that would make the game less fun. Various things that happen in some of these war games obviously neglect reality. Just the way you shoot enemies and they magically recover health or just generally don't suffer consequences of being shot. Would it really be fun after being shot in the foot to be limping around? Or shot in your arm and unable to aim with that arm?

    It's all just dumb entertainment with little resemblance to reality of than the objects within are real objects that exist. You can't take it seriously.
